Replacing your vehicle's anti-lock braking system module can seem daunting, but with thorough planning and basic mechanical knowledge, it’s a achievable task. First, obtain the appropriate replacement part – verify its compatibility with your brand. Next, disconnect the minus battery cable to prevent electrical issues. Then, find the ABS controller, usually situated near the master cylinder or below the dashboard. Carefully separate the electrical connectors and unfasten any fasteners holding the module. Finally, mount the new unit in reverse order, double-checking all connections are firm before joining the battery cable. Remember to refer to your car's repair guide for detailed instructions.

Replacing Your ABS Module - Cost & Considerations

Getting an ABS unit substitute can be a significant expense, and it's important to understand the aspects involved. The cost can differ widely, typically ranging between $300 and $1500. This total includes both the part itself and the work for fitting. Home mechanics might lower on installing costs by attempting the replacement themselves, but this requires a good level of automotive skill and the correct tools. Alternatively, taking your vehicle to a repair shop will guarantee proper assessment and installation, though it will come a greater overall price. Before proceeding, evaluate whether your system can be fixed versus completely swapped out, as reconditioning might be a less affordable option.
